Yankees - Red Sox
Definition
A legendary and bitter rivalry in Major League Baseball between the New York Yankees (American League East) and the Boston Red Sox (also American League East), dating back over a century and marked by dramatic games, curses, and fanatical supporters.
Colloquially, an emblem of intense sports competition in American culture, often shorthand for high-stakes drama, trash-talking, and divided loyalties among East Coast fans.
